In this episode of Heard Mentality, we sit down with Westpac’s Chief Growth and Marketing Officer, Michelle Klein, to unpack how one of Australia’s most established brands found a powerful new idea… hidden in plain sight.

From unlocking the iconic “W” to creating a custom song that audiences instantly connected with, this conversation explores how simplicity, creativity and sound can transform how a brand shows up — and how it’s remembered.

Michelle shares the thinking behind Westpac’s latest brand platform, why music became the centrepiece of the campaign, and how sonic branding can act as a powerful “mnemonic device” — building memory, emotion and long-term brand equity.
